To reach these eastern … WebJun 1, 2012 · Make your own nectar. When your flowers aren't blooming, feeders will help attract hummingbirds. Mix one part sugar with four parts tap water. Sugar dissolves quickly in warm water, so there's no need to boil it. When nectarlooks cloudy or moldy, wash the feeder and refill with a fresh batch.While a traditional feeder is hung off a house or on ...

WebAnna’s Hummingbirds are accidental species in Missouri, but they were last spotted in Kimberling City in 2024. Anna’s Hummingbirds are tiny birds that are primarily green and gray. The male’s head and throat are iridescent reddish-pink. The female’s throat is grayish with bits of red spotting. WebMar 21, 2024 · Wingspan: 4 inches. If you see a hummingbird with an exotic red neck, you’re probably seeing a Ruby-throated Hummingbird. They’re small hummingbirds with emerald green backs and crowns. Females and young birds have white necks, while males have red necks. They’re the most common species of hummingbirds in Missouri.
